Why a Wallet Address Is Not Enough for Business Payments

A wallet address can receive crypto. But receiving crypto is only the first step. Businesses need to know who paid, what they paid for, whether the payment is complete, and what should happen next.
But business payments are not only about receiving funds. A company also needs to know who paid, what the transfer belongs to, whether the amount is correct, whether the transaction is confirmed, what the customer should see next, and how finance will find that record later.
This is where many companies misunderstand crypto payments.
They think accepting crypto starts and ends with showing a wallet address. For a private transfer between two people, that may be enough. For an online business, it usually creates more manual work than expected.
A business does not just need a crypto wallet. It needs a payment process.
A wallet address solves only the first step
A wallet address answers one question: where should the customer send crypto?
It does not automatically answer the next questions:
Which customer sent this transfer?Which invoice, purchase, subscription, or account does it belong to?Was the exact amount received?Was the right asset and network used?Is the transaction confirmed enough to continue?What should support tell the customer?Can finance export the record later?
These questions sound boring compared with the usual crypto narrative. But for merchants, they are the real operating layer.
A wallet address can show that funds arrived. It cannot turn that transfer into a clean business event by itself.
Why manual checking breaks quickly
Manual checking may look manageable at the beginning.
A customer sends USDT. Someone from the team opens a block explorer, checks the amount, looks at the time, compares it with the customer message, and then updates the internal system by hand.
This can work for one or two payments. It becomes fragile when volume grows.
The team starts dealing with repeated questions:
“I paid. Why is my account not updated?”“I used the wrong network. What happens now?”“I sent slightly less than requested. Is it accepted?”“Can you confirm this transaction?”“Where is the record for this payment?”
None of these problems mean crypto payments are bad. They mean the business has no structured crypto checkout.
The customer sees a transfer. The company needs a verified status, a record, and a clear next step.
Wallet address vs business payment infrastructure
The difference becomes clearer in practice:
Receiving funds
Wallet address: Receives crypto.Payment infrastructure: Handles crypto payments through a structured process.
Customer matching
Wallet address: Requires manual payment identification.Payment infrastructure: Links payments to invoices, orders, or customers.
Amount control
Wallet address: Requires manual checking.Payment infrastructure: Verifies expected and received amounts automatically.
Payment status
Wallet address: Requires blockchain checks.Payment infrastructure: Shows statuses like waiting, paid, expired, or underpaid.
Support & records
Wallet address: Relies on manual verification and fragmented history.Payment infrastructure: Provides clear payment records for support and reporting.
Scaling
Wallet address: Becomes difficult to manage with higher volumes.Payment infrastructure: Designed for repeatable business payments.
A wallet is a destination. A crypto payment gateway turns it into a complete payment process with tracking, automation, and business tools.
The hidden work behind a simple crypto checkout
Good crypto checkout should feel simple to the customer.
The customer chooses a coin, sees the amount, sends funds, and waits for the result.
Behind that simple screen, the business needs several things to happen correctly:
A payment request is created with the expected asset, network, amount, and time limit.The system monitors the blockchain for the matching transfer.The received amount and asset are checked against the request.The transaction receives the required level of confirmation.The customer sees a clear status.The merchant gets a clean payment record.Finance and support can work with the payment without guessing.
This is why crypto payment infrastructure matters. It hides the operational complexity without pretending that the complexity does not exist.
For the customer, the experience should be clear. For the business, the result should be structured.
Common mistakes when businesses use only a wallet address
The first mistake is using one address for many customers.
If several people send similar amounts in the same period, matching transfers becomes a manual puzzle. The team may need screenshots, transaction hashes, customer messages, and time comparisons to understand what happened.
The second mistake is ignoring network choice.
USDT can move across different networks. If the customer chooses the wrong one, the support process can become slow and confusing. A proper payment page makes the expected network clear before the transfer happens.
The third mistake is treating “funds arrived” as the same thing as “payment completed.”
For a business, completion depends on matching, amount, asset, network, confirmation, and internal status. Seeing value on-chain is only one part of the payment decision.
The fourth mistake is leaving finance out of the process.
If every crypto transfer is checked manually, finance later has to reconstruct what happened. That may be acceptable for a small test, but it is not a stable process for regular business crypto payments.
The fifth mistake is making support depend on the blockchain.
Support teams should not need to interpret every transaction from scratch. They need clear internal records: expected amount, received amount, status, time, asset, and customer reference.
When a wallet address can still be enough
There are cases where a wallet address is fine.
If a founder receives one-off transfers from trusted partners, or a small team tests crypto manually before building a real payment flow, a wallet may be enough for a short period.
But the moment crypto becomes a customer payment method, the standard changes.
A business needs consistency. Customers need clarity. Support needs answers. Finance needs records. Product teams need a reliable result after checkout.
That is difficult to maintain with only a wallet address.
What a business should look for instead
A business that wants to accept crypto payments should look beyond the address itself.
The useful checklist is practical:
Can each payment be tied to a specific customer action?Does the checkout show the right asset, network, amount, and timer?Can the system detect underpaid and overpaid transfers?Are statuses clear for both the customer and the merchant?Can support see what happened without asking for screenshots first?Can finance export or review payment records later?Can the process handle repeat payments without manual checking every time?
This is the difference between receiving crypto and operating crypto payments.
The first is a wallet function. The second is payment infrastructure.
Final takeaway
A wallet address is useful, but it is not a complete business payment system.
For online companies, the real question is not only “Can we receive crypto?”
The better question is: “Can we turn each crypto transfer into a clear, trackable, support-friendly and finance-readable payment?”
That is why businesses that accept crypto payments usually need more than a wallet address. They need a structured crypto checkout, a clear status flow, and payment records that make sense after the transaction is complete.
The best crypto payment experience feels simple to the customer and does not force the business to verify everything manually.

5 Common Mistakes Businesses Make When Accepting Crypto

Why a wallet address is not enough when crypto payments become part of daily business operations.
Many businesses think accepting crypto is as simple as sharing a wallet address. That works at the beginning, but daily payments quickly reveal the hidden operational challenges behind crypto checkout.
A crypto transaction is not only a transfer from one wallet to another. For a business, it has to connect with pricing, customer support, finance records, refunds, internal access, and the way the team confirms that a sale is finished. If that process is not clear, crypto payments can create more manual work than expected.
This does not mean businesses should avoid crypto. It means they should treat it as a payment method, not as a shortcut.
Here are five common mistakes businesses make when they start to accept crypto payments.
Treating a wallet address as a payment system
The most basic mistake is assuming that a wallet address is enough.
A wallet can receive funds. It does not explain who paid, what the transfer was for, whether the amount matches the expected price, or what the next internal step should be.
This may work when there are only a few manual sales. Someone checks the wallet, compares the amount, and updates a spreadsheet. But as volume grows, this becomes slow and easy to misread.
A business needs more than a receiving address. It needs a clear payment record: customer reference, amount, asset, network, status, time, and a way for finance or support to understand the transaction later.
Without that structure, the wallet becomes a shared inbox for money movement. Everyone can see that funds arrived, but not everyone can understand what the transfer means.
Imagine receiving 20 USDT payments in one day from different customers for subscriptions, invoices, and digital products.
Ignoring network and asset differences
Many first-time crypto payment setups focus only on the coin name. For example, a customer wants to pay in USDT, and the business says it accepts USDT.
But USDT can move on different networks. The same asset name does not always mean the same transfer route, cost, timing, or wallet setup.
This is where mistakes happen. A customer may send funds on the wrong network. The business may expect one chain and receive another. A support team may see a transaction hash but not know how to check it correctly.
For non-technical customers, this is confusing. For finance teams, it creates extra review work.
Businesses that accept crypto payments should make the asset and network clear before the customer sends funds. The payment page, internal record, and support instructions should all match. If the team has to guess the network after the transfer, the process is already weaker than it should be.
Forgetting that finance needs records, not just confirmations
A blockchain confirmation proves that a transaction was recorded on-chain. It does not automatically create a clean business record.
Finance teams need to know why money arrived, which customer or partner it belongs to, how it should be treated internally, and whether anything still needs review.
This is one of the biggest differences between personal crypto use and business crypto payments. A person may only care that funds arrived. A company has to explain the transaction later.
That explanation matters for support, monthly reporting, refunds, partner balances, and management review. If the business relies only on wallet history or blockchain explorers, finance has to rebuild the story manually.
A better process keeps the transaction and the business context close together. The goal is not to make crypto more complicated. The goal is to make every crypto payment understandable after the first check is finished.
Making support handle unclear payments manually
When crypto payments are not properly tracked, support teams often become the safety net.
A customer says they paid. Support asks for a hash. Someone checks a blockchain explorer. Another person checks the wallet. Finance confirms later. The customer waits while the company reconstructs what happened.
This creates a poor experience even when the payment itself was successful.
The problem is not usually the blockchain. The problem is that the business does not have a simple status that everyone can trust.
Support should not need to become a blockchain investigation team. They should be able to see whether the transfer is waiting, confirmed, under review, expired, or mismatched. The same record should be understandable to finance and operations, not only to the person who first set up the wallet.
If every unclear transfer requires a chat thread and a manual check, crypto payments will feel harder than card payments even when settlement is technically working.
Thinking crypto payments end when funds arrive
For a customer, payment may feel finished when funds are sent. For a business, that is only one part of the process.
After funds arrive, the company may still need to update access, mark a sale as paid, issue a record, handle partial transfers, review repeated payments, process a refund, or send funds to partners.
This is where many crypto payment setups become messy. The receiving step works, but the operating process around it is incomplete.
The stronger approach is to think about the full flow before volume grows: what the customer sees, what finance sees, what support sees, and what happens when the transfer does not match expectations.
A crypto payment gateway, payment infrastructure, or structured internal process can help because it turns a raw transaction into something the business can actually work with.
Many businesses focus on receiving crypto but forget everything that happens after: updating subscriptions, notifying customers, reconciling payments, and handling exceptions.
The practical takeaway
Crypto payments are not difficult because blockchains are impossible to understand. They become difficult when a business treats a transfer as the whole process.
Accepting crypto well means connecting the transaction with customer context, payment status, internal records, support handling, and finance review.
A wallet can receive funds. A blockchain explorer can verify a transaction. But a business still needs a process that tells the team what to do next.
The best crypto payment systems hide complexity from customers while giving businesses the control, records, and automation they need behind the scenes.
